Output b53a780c07c3aa683054079263b0ee4282bb0fa008388179b5560f74a81f1aba:3

value
26989678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ac8a3fbfe29bf40eb03173243f155697750070 OP_EQUAL
address
M8KsdVLMFLfAixiXcVvXpMnoCpdAKjnubV
transaction
b53a780c07c3aa683054079263b0ee4282bb0fa008388179b5560f74a81f1aba
spent
true